Guided procurement is a compliance-first purchasing approach that uses automated rules and workflows to steer employees toward approved suppliers, contracts, and catalog items. It reduces maverick spend and ensures purchasing decisions align with corporate sourcing strategies.
Guided procurement platforms typically integrate with ERP systems and provide intuitive buying experiences similar to consumer e-commerce. By embedding policy guardrails into the purchasing process, organizations can improve contract compliance, negotiate better terms, and maintain spend visibility across the enterprise.
